RRB NTPC Recruitment 2025: 8850 Vacancies for Graduate and UnderGraduate

The Railway Recruitment Board (RRB) has issued a short notification for RRB NTPC Recruitment 2025 on 29 September 2025 via official channels. Indian Railways will hire 8850 candidates under Non-Technical Popular Categories (NTPC) across Graduate and Undergraduate levels in multiple zones and production units.

Detailed advertisements—CEN 06/2025 (Graduate) and CEN 07/2025 (Undergraduate)—will be published soon. Online registration opens 21 October 2025 for graduates and 28 October 2025 for undergraduates. Selection Process

The recruitment pipeline includes five stages:

  1. CBT-1 (Prelims)

  2. CBT-2 (Mains)

  3. Typing Skill Test / Aptitude Test (post-specific)

  4. Document Verification

  5. Medical Examination

Exam Pattern

CBT-1

Subject Questions Marks Duration
Mathematics 30 30
General Intelligence & Reasoning 30 30 90 minutes
General Awareness 40 40
Total 100 100 90 minutes
  • Negative marking: –⅓ per incorrect answer.

CBT-2

Subject Questions Marks Duration
Mathematics 35 35
General Intelligence & Reasoning 35 35 90 minutes
General Awareness 50 50
Total 120 120 90 minutes
